Media Store」タグアーカイブ

Kotlin:useスコープ関数

投稿日:  更新日:

useスコープ関数は、オブジェクトが確保したリソースの開放(close関数の実行)を自動的に行ってくれる関数です。 とてもお勧めのスコープ関数です。 ※環境:Android Studio Hedgehog | 2023. … 続きを読む

Media StoreでcreateDeleteRequestを使ったファイルの削除

投稿日:  更新日:

既存のメディアファイルへ、アクセスする許可を取得するためのリクエストが、Media Store APIに準備されています。 このリクエストで許可を得たアプリは、ファイルの所有者に関係なく、アクセスが可能になります。 この … 続きを読む

Media Storeで他アプリが所有するファイルへ書き込み

投稿日:  更新日:

メディアデータはアプリ間で共有されるので、アプリがデータへアクセスするには、アクセス許可が必要です。 この許可の権限の範囲は、プライバシー保護の観点から、徐々に狭められてきました。 そして、対象範囲別ストレージにおいて、 … 続きを読む

Media Storeでファイル名とバケットを指定したアクセス(API≧29)

投稿日:  更新日:

メディアデータはMedia Storeを使ったアクセスが最適です。 その理由は、メディア特有の付加情報を使って、データを管理できるからです。 管理されたデータはブログラムから扱い易いです。また、ユーザの使い勝手(エクスペ … 続きを読む

Media Storeでファイル名とバケットを指定したアクセス(API≦28)

投稿日:  更新日:

メディアデータはMedia Storeを使ったアクセスが最適です。 その理由は、メディア特有の付加情報を使って、データを管理できるからです。 管理されたデータはブログラムから扱い易いです。また、ユーザの使い勝手(エクスペ … 続きを読む